Transaction caa63a793f6fb2ea0a8c5d739eb6213ed48a1e61ef064d4eb994ddbebb869f52
2 Input
2 Outputs
- caa63a793f6fb2ea0a8c5d739eb6213ed48a1e61ef064d4eb994ddbebb869f52:0
- caa63a793f6fb2ea0a8c5d739eb6213ed48a1e61ef064d4eb994ddbebb869f52:1
value 11726833
address 12QG8Y6DFRTDR5YLkmcUstPLKKmtVNM7Wk
value 33890000
address 3LqRRq7oYNGQoEhvALCSSjNcUDD6iJS8av